Subject: Re: Water system not priming

I had the same problem on my '81 FC. Both the Sporlan valve and the hot water tank drain valve were bad. Actually, both of there valves have the same effect and neither can be in open position when the pump is to provide water because the pump is simply returning water to the tank. Both of these valves are expensive from BB. I solved my problem by replacing the hot water valve with a ball valve and did away with the Sporlan. Naturally, the fill switch no longer works w/o the Sporlan so I added a short brass rod from the ball valve handle through a small hole I drilled to the utility compartment.
